Application Process
Students only need to submit one application to be eligible for any of the department scholarships. The number and dollar amount of awards varies annually, depending on funding availability. Applications from women, minorities, students with disabilities, and other underrepresented students are strongly encouraged.

Eligibility requirements:
- A minimum of two semesters at KU
- 3.0 or higher GPA
- Must be pursuing a degree in Geography or Atmospheric Science
- Full-time Student
- Not graduating Spring 2023
Selection criteria depend on the scholarship, which may include one or more of the following:
- Course performance
- Contribution to the department and fellow students (e.g. leadership in student organization)
- Originality and independence displayed in an undergrad research project
Application requirements:
- Completion of the application form
- Unofficial transcript
